摘要
In order to meet the requirement of the real-time data surveying of land utilization, an efficacious land survey GPS handset system was presented in this paper. In the system, a design pattern based framework was given out to increase its reusability, flexility and maintainability of Embedding GIS. Encapsulation for command like actions by applying COMMAND pattern was proposed for the problem of complex UI interactions. Integrating several GPS-log parsing engines into a general parsing framework was archived by introducing STRATEGY pattern. A network transmission module based network middleware was constructed. For mitigating the high coupling of complex network communication programs, FACTORY pattern was applied to facilitate the decoupling. Moreover, in order to efficiently manipulate huge GIS datasets, a VISITOR pattern and Quad-tree based multi-scale representation method was presented. It had been proved practically that these design patterns reduced the coupling between the subsystems, and improved the expansibility, flexility and maintainability.
